    Mutation of the N-terminal proline 9 of BLMA from Streptomyces verticillus abolishes the binding affinity for bleomycin

    AbstractA gene, blmA, from bleomycin (Bm)-producing Streptomyces verticillus, encodes a Bm-binding protein, designated BLMA. The expression of BLMA conferred resistance to Bm in the Escherichia coli host, whereas a mutant protein, designated Pro-9/Leu, with the N-terminal proline 9 residue in BLMA replaced by leucine, did not. We created a fusion protein between the maltose-binding protein (MBP) and a mutant protein Pro-9/Leu/Leu with Met-94 in Pro-9/Leu replaced by leucine. Pro-9/Leu/Leu from the fusion protein, obtained by digestion with CNBr digestion, did not inhibit DNA-cleaving and antibacterial activities of Bm. Native-polyacrylamide gel electrophoresis (PAGE) and gel filtration column chromatographic analysis showed that the molecular size of Pro-9/Leu/Leu is roughly half of that of BLMA, suggesting that the mutant protein cannot form dimeric structure. Furthermore, Far-UV circular dichroism (CD) spectrum of Pro-9/Leu/Leu was quite different from that of BLMA and similar to the spectra obtained from unordered proteins [Venyaminov, S.Y. and Vassilenko, K.S. (1994) Anal. Biochem. 222, 176–184], suggesting that the secondary structure of Pro-9/Leu/Leu is disrupted. These results indicate that the mutation abolishes not only dimer formation but also the secondary structure of BLMA, which results in the loss of its function as a Bm-resistance determinant

    A Raman Lidar with a Deep Ultraviolet Laser for Continuous Water Vapor Profiling in the Atmospheric Boundary Layer

    A Raman lidar with a deep ultraviolet laser was constructed to continuously monitor water vapor distributions in the atmospheric boundary layer for twenty-four hours. We employ a laser at a wavelength of 266 nm and detects the light separated into an elastic backscatter signal and vibrational Raman signals of oxygen, nitrogen, and water vapor. The lidar was encased in a temperature-controlled and vibration-isolated compact container, resistant to a variety of environmental conditions. Water vapor profile observations were made for twelve months from November 24, 2017, to November 29, 2018. These observations were compared with collocated radiosonde measurements for daytime and nighttime conditions

    Analysis of the Relationship between Hypertrophy of the Ligamentum Flavum and Lumbar Segmental Motion with Aging Process

    Study DesignRetrospective cross-sectional study.PurposeTo investigate the relationship between ligamentum flavum (LF) hypertrophy and lumbar segmental motion.Overview of LiteratureThe pathogenesis of LF thickening is unclear and whether the thickening results from tissue hypertrophy or buckling remains controversial.Methods296 consecutive patients underwent assessment of the lumbar spine by radiographic and magnetic resonance imaging (MRI). Of these patients, 39 with normal L4–L5 disc height were selected to exclude LF buckling as one component of LF hypertrophy. The study group included 27 men and 12 women, with an average age of 61.2 years (range, 23–81 years). Disc degeneration and LF thickness were quantified on MRI. Lumbar segmental spine instability and presence of a vacuum phenomenon were identified on radiographic images.ResultsThe distribution of disc degeneration and LF thickness included grade II degeneration in 4 patients, with a mean LF thickness of 2.43±0.20 mm; grade III in 10 patients, 3.01±0.41 mm; and grade IV in 25 patients, 4.16±1.12 mm. LF thickness significantly increased with grade of disc degeneration and was significantly correlated with age (r=0.55, p<0.01). Logistic regression analysis identified predictive effects of segmental angulation (odds ratio [OR]=1.55, p=0.014) and age (OR=1.16, p=0.008).ConclusionsAge-related increases in disc degeneration, combined with continuous lumbar segmental flexion-extension motion, leads to the development of LF hypertrophy

    Analysis of the Prevalence and Distribution of Cervical and Thoracic Compressive Lesions of the Spinal Cord in Lumbar Degenerative Disease

    Study DesignRetrospective study.PurposeThe aim of the present study is to analyze the prevalence and distribution of cervical and thoracic compressive lesions of the spinal cord in lumbar degenerative disease, using whole-spine postmyelographic computed tomography.Overview of LiteratureOf the various complications resulting from spinal surgery, unexpected neurological deterioration is the most undesired. There are reports of missed compressive lesions of the spinal cord at the cervical or thoracic level in lumbar degenerative disease.MethodsThere were 145 consecutive patients with symptomatic lumbar degenerative disease evaluated. Before the lumbar surgery, image data were obtained. The following parameters at the cervical and thoracic levels were analyzed: compressive lesions from the anterior parts; compressive lesions from the anterior and posterior parts; ossification of the ligamentum flavum; ossification of the posterior longitudinal ligament; and spinal cord tumor.ResultsCompressive lesions from the anterior parts were observed in 34 cases (23.4%). Compressive lesions from the anterior and posterior parts were observed in 34 cases (23.4%). Lesions of ossification of the ligamentum flavum were observed in 45 cases (31.0%). Lesions of ossification of the posterior longitudinal ligament were observed in 15 cases (10.3%). Spinal cord tumor was not observed.ConclusionsA survey of compressive lesions at the cervical or thoracic level in lumbar degenerative disease is important in preventing unexpected neurological deterioration after the lumbar surgery

    Predictable Imaging Signs of Cauda Equina Entrapment in Thoracolumbar and Lumbar Burst Fractures with Greenstick Lamina Fractures

    Study DesignA retrospective study.PurposeThe aim of present study was to investigate imaging findings suggestive of cauda equina entrapment in thoracolumbar and lumbar burst fractures.Overview of LiteratureBurst fractures with cauda equina entrapment can cause neurologic deterioration during surgery. However, dural tears and cauda equina entrapment are very difficult to diagnose clinically or radiographically before surgery.MethodsTwenty-three patients who underwent spinal surgery for thoracolumbar or lumbar burst fractures were enrolled in this study. In magnetic resonance imaging T2-weighted images of the transverse plane, we defined cauda equina notch sign (CENS) as a v-shaped image that entrapped cauda equina gathers between lamina fractures. We evaluated the fractured spine by using CENS and lamina fractures and the rate of available space for the spinal canal at the narrowest portion of the burst fracture level. We classified patients into entrapment group or non-entrapment group, based on whether cauda equina entrapment existed.ResultsLamina fractures were detected in 18 (78.3%) and CENS were detected in 6 (26.1%) of 23 burst-fracture patients. Cauda equina entrapment existed in all the patients with CENS. In addition, the rate of available space for the spinal canal increased according to logistic regression. The size of the retropulsed fragment in the spinal canal was the most reliable of all the factors, suggesting cauda equina entrapment.ConclusionsCENS was the most predictable sign of cauda equina entrapment associated with burst fractures

    Successful use of dupilumab for egg-induced eosinophilic gastroenteritis with duodenal ulcer: a pediatric case report and review of literature

    Background Non-esophageal eosinophilic gastrointestinal disorder (non-EoE-EGID) is a rare disease in which eosinophils infiltrate parts of the gastrointestinal tract other than the esophagus; however, the number of patients with non-EoE-EGID has been increasing in recent years. Owing to its chronic course with repeated relapses, it can lead to developmental delays due to malnutrition, especially in pediatric patients. No established treatment exists for non-EoE-EGID, necessitating long-term systemic corticosteroid administration. Although the efficacy of dupilumab, an anti-IL-4/13 receptor monoclonal antibody, for eosinophilic esophagitis, has been reported, only few reports have demonstrated its efficacy in non-EoE EGIDs. Case presentation A 13-year-old boy developed non-EoE-EGID with duodenal ulcers, with chicken eggs as the trigger. He was successfully treated with an egg-free diet, proton pump inhibitors, and leukotriene receptor antagonists. However, at age 15, he developed worsening upper abdominal pain and difficulty eating. Blood analysis revealed eosinophilia; elevated erythrocyte sedimentation rate; and elevated levels of C-reactive protein, total immunoglobulin E, and thymic and activation-regulated chemokines. Upper gastrointestinal endoscopy revealed a duodenal ulcer with marked mucosal eosinophilic infiltration. Gastrointestinal symptoms persisted even after starting systemic steroids, making it difficult to reduce the steroid dose. Subcutaneous injection of dupilumab was initiated because of comorbid atopic dermatitis exacerbation. After 3 months, the gastrointestinal symptoms disappeared, and after 5 months, the duodenal ulcer disappeared and the eosinophil count decreased in the mucosa. Six months later, systemic steroids were discontinued, and the duodenal ulcer remained recurrence-free. The egg challenge test result was negative; therefore, the egg-free diet was discontinued. Blood eosinophil count and serum IL-5, IL-13, and eotaxin-3 levels decreased after dupilumab treatment. The serum levels of IL-5 and eotaxin-3 remained within normal ranges, although the blood eosinophil counts increased again after discontinuation of oral prednisolone. Conclusions Suppression of IL-4R/IL-13R-mediated signaling by dupilumab may improve abdominal symptoms and endoscopic and histologic findings in patients with non-EoE-EGID, leading to the discontinuation of systemic steroid administration and tolerance of causative foods
